On the afternoon of September 11, we were done a little early and ended up going for an extra hike to see some amazing rare plants. Along the way there was also magnificent views of Kalalau Valley. Largely undeveloped by modern man, the only viable ways in and out are either on foot or by boat. Many take the 11 mile hike in and out. Others kayak in during the Summer when the waves are small. Camping permits allow people to camp there for 5 days. Of course there people who have illegally camped there for years long over staying their 5 days.
